For decades, legacy ERP systems served as the backbone of business operations. They managed accounting, procurement, inventory, and production, but often in rigid, isolated silos. Customizations were time-consuming and costly, and upgrades could take months or even years. As industries evolved, these legacy systems struggled to keep pace with digital demands like real-time analytics, automation, and cloud scalability. Businesses found themselves spending more time maintaining outdated systems than innovating or responding to market changes. This pain point created an opportunity — a demand for agile solutions that understood not just how businesses operate, but how their specific industries function at the core.
That’s where Industry-Specific SAP Solutions come into play. Unlike generic ERP systems, SAP’s industry-focused offerings are built around sector-specific best practices, data models, and regulatory frameworks. They don’t just manage processes — they optimize them according to the way your industry works. Whether it’s a manufacturing firm automating its production line, a healthcare provider managing patient data securely, or a retailer optimizing its supply chain, SAP’s tailored solutions bring intelligence and flexibility directly to the heart of operations.
Consider manufacturing, for example. Traditional ERP systems could manage inventory and production scheduling, but they lacked the agility to handle modern smart factory operations. SAP’s manufacturing-specific solutions integrate Internet of Things (IoT) sensors, predictive maintenance, and digital twin technology, allowing manufacturers to anticipate machine failures, optimize resource allocation, and ensure seamless production. The result is not just efficiency but resilience — a key trait in today’s unpredictable global supply chains.
Retail tells a similar story. Customers now expect hyper-personalized experiences across both physical and digital touchpoints. Legacy systems that separate online and offline data can no longer deliver this. SAP’s retail-specific solutions unify customer, inventory, and sales data in real time, enabling businesses to understand buyer behavior, predict demand, and deliver tailored promotions instantly. From grocery chains to luxury brands, companies are leveraging these solutions to blend e-commerce and in-store experiences seamlessly.
In healthcare, SAP’s industry-specific solutions are transforming how organizations manage patient care and compliance. By connecting clinical, administrative, and financial data, hospitals and healthcare providers gain a holistic view of operations. They can ensure regulatory compliance, manage patient records securely, and optimize resources to deliver better outcomes. For an industry where accuracy and speed can save lives, the value of an integrated, intelligent system cannot be overstated.
Even in finance, where precision and compliance are paramount, industry-specific SAP solutions help institutions automate risk management, improve transparency, and ensure compliance with ever-changing regulations. The financial sector, once burdened by legacy systems that resisted change, now uses SAP’s intelligent platforms to streamline processes, reduce errors, and improve decision-making with real-time data analytics.

Another major advantage of Industry-Specific SAP Solutions is speed to value. Because they come preconfigured with industry best practices, implementation times are significantly shorter than traditional ERP deployments. Companies no longer have to spend months customizing systems to meet their needs. Instead, they can focus on refining processes and accelerating outcomes. This is especially valuable for mid-sized enterprises that need agility without the resource burden of large-scale custom projects.
Cloud technology amplifies these benefits even further. SAP S/4HANA Cloud, combined with SAP’s industry-specific capabilities, gives organizations the flexibility to scale globally while maintaining local compliance and performance. Businesses can adopt a modular approach — starting with core functionalities and expanding as needed. This ensures that the technology grows with the business, not the other way around. It’s a major departure from the static legacy architectures of the past, which often locked companies into outdated processes.
The global push toward sustainability is another factor driving the adoption of industry-specific SAP solutions. SAP’s platforms include sustainability tracking tools that allow businesses to measure and reduce their environmental impact. For example, manufacturers can monitor energy usage across factories, while logistics firms can optimize routes to reduce emissions. By embedding sustainability into operational processes, companies can meet regulatory requirements and demonstrate social responsibility — both increasingly important to customers and investors.
